Mono-Bipolar Electrocautery Unit, high frequency electronic scalpel for microcoagulation

Mono-Bipolar Electrocautery Unit, high frequency electronic scalpel for microcoagulationHF 122 is a complete innovation in the electrosurgery field. It is a high frequency-electronic scalpel suitable for microcoagulation, small and medium MonoPolar surgery and BiPolar coagulation. The following MonoPolar modes of operation are available via the control panel: pure cutting (CUT), coagulated cutting (COAG), MonoPolar coagulation and microcoagulation (BLEND). Additionally with BiPolar forceps, bipolar coagulation and microcoagulation are available.

Oesophageal Forceps Jaws, Foreign bodies lodged

Oesophageal Forceps Jaws, Foreign bodies lodgedForeign bodies lodged in either the oesophagus or the trachea occur on a regular basis and are a challenge for the surgeon to locate, visualise and remove. Our ‘family’ of foreign body forceps are designed specifically for this purpose.

  * Backward facing teeth for maximum grip

  * Profile of jaws as small as possible

  * Jaws externally as atraumatic as possible to minimise damage to patient.

  * Shaft diameter as small as possible to allow placement of endoscope along side.

  • Clipping a Dog's Broken Toenail
    Dogs’ toenails will often break on their own, learn what to do when your dog has a broken toenail, in this free pet health care video with tips from a veterinarian. It’s not uncommon for a dog to break a toenail. It most often occurs when you trim his nails with clippers, but accidents can cause the toenail to break as well. Since the toenail is likely to bleed a lot, you need to take action right away.
    • Stop the bleeding. A dog’s nail is going to bleed a lot when it’s broken. Simply holding a bandage over it usually won’t make it stop. Instead, use a coagulant to pack the wound. Substances that can be used include flour, powder, cornstarch or a styptic powder.
    • Get an over the counter antibiotic cream to place over the broken nail. A generous amount should be applied in order to prevent infection and promote healing.
    • Put a bandage over the area. You can secure the bandage using vet or surgical tape. The area should not be wrapped too tightly and cut off circulation.
    • Cover the bandage with a sock. The sock is used to protect the area and keep the dog from trying to get at the wound. Since the sock is not likely to stay in place on its own, you may have to use more vet tape.
    • Keep a close eye on the dog for the next few days. If the nail does not seem to heal or the dog starts limping, you should make an appointment with the vet.
    • In order to prevent future broken nails, you should learn about how to properly cut a dog’s nails. A vet can let you know how to do it, or you can read a dog care handbook.
    • If your dog is in pain from the broken toenail, you’ll need to have someone hold him or use a muzzle during treatment.

  • Prevent Wound Infection
    When a large number of bacteria get into a wound, it can get infected. There are different types of bacteria. More than one type may infect your wound at the same time. Normal bacteria that live on your skin often enter a wound first. A break in the skin gives them a chance to enter it and cause infection. Bacteria may also come from the environment, such as soil, air, or water. If an object such as a nail caused the wound, bacteria may come from that. If you are bit by an animal or person, their saliva could also cause infection. A wound infection happens when germs enter a break in the skin. These germs, called bacteria, attach to tissues causing wounds to stop healing, and other signs and symptoms. Wound infection can also happen in small wounds that were not treated. Anything that decreases your body’s ability to heal wounds may put you at risk for a wound infection.
